How much do partnership success manager jobs pay per year?

As of Aug 21, 2026, the average yearly pay for partnership success manager in Utah is $75,619.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$54,200.00 and $90,100.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

How does a Partnership Success Manager collaborate with internal teams to ensure partner satisfaction?

Partnership Success Managers work closely with various internal departments—such as sales, marketing, product, and customer support—to deliver a cohesive experience for partners. They often serve as the main communication bridge, relaying partner feedback, coordinating joint initiatives, and troubleshooting issues that may arise. This cross-functional collaboration ensures that partner needs are met promptly and that mutual goals are aligned, which is critical for long-term partnership success.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Partnership Success Manager?

To thrive as a Partnership Success Manager, you need strong relationship management skills, business acumen, and experience in account management or client-facing roles, often supported by a bachelor’s degree in business or a related field. Familiarity with CRM software, data analytics tools, and project management systems is typically required. Outstanding communication, problem-solving abilities, and the capacity to collaborate across teams help individuals excel in this position. These skills are crucial for building trust, driving partner satisfaction, and ensuring mutual growth in strategic partnerships.

What is the difference between Partnership Success Manager vs Account Manager?

AspectPartnership Success ManagerAccount Manager
Primary FocusBuilding and maintaining strategic partnerships, ensuring mutual growthManaging client accounts, ensuring customer satisfaction and retention
Work EnvironmentCollaborative, often with external partners and internal teamsCustomer-facing, primarily with existing clients
Required SkillsRelationship management, strategic planning, communicationCustomer service, sales, problem-solving

The Partnership Success Manager focuses on developing and nurturing strategic partnerships to drive mutual success, while the Account Manager primarily manages existing client accounts to ensure satisfaction and retention. Both roles require strong relationship skills but differ in scope and objectives.

What you own:
Technical Success Managers (TSMs) collaborate closely with the Customer Success Managers (CSMs) to support customers through their entire customer journey with LoanPro, including implementation. They are customer facing, strategic, product subject-matter experts. They are solutionists, builders, sellers, and project managers, responsible for exemplifying excellent customer service and LoanPro core values, culture, policy and procedures at all times.
Essential Job Functions:
  • Takes ownership of deep learning about our software, its functions, and how it fulfills our customers' needs and how they use the product
  • Support the CSMs in technical calls, upselling, and building new requirements
  • Collaborate with the Solution Architects on larger solutions
  • Collaborate with customers to gather and understand their technical requirements, business goals, and objectives in order to design and architect solutions that leverage our platform to meet those requirements.
  • Provide technical guidance and best practices to existing customers for integrating our platform with existing systems and workflows.
  • Create detailed technical documentation, including architecture diagrams, solution design specs, and integration guides.
  • Work closely with product and engineering teams to communicate customer feedback and drive continuous improvement of our platform.
  • Advocate for customer needs within the organization, ensuring that their feedback is considered in product development and enhancements.
  • Stay up-to-date with industry trends, emerging technologies, and best practices to continuously improve the solutions provided to customers.
  • Collaborate with internal teams to develop and refine processes, tools, and resources that enhance the customer experience.
  • An essential function of this role requires onsite work to collaborate with other team members. Remote work can be conducted at managers discretion and in accordance with company hybrid policy, although the first 90 days are expected to be in office completely to accommodate in person training.
